Vivint Playback DVR Features and Performance
The Vivint Playback DVR records video continuously, helping you capture activity that motion-triggered systems can sometimes miss. Instead of relying only on event clips, you get a complete timeline of recorded footage.
Key features include:
- 24/7 continuous video recording
- AI-powered person, vehicle, package, and motion detection
- Timeline-based video search
- Mobile playback through the Vivint app
- Video clip exporting and sharing
- Support for up to 12 connected cameras
- Event markers for faster footage review
During testing and customer feedback reviews, one feature consistently stands out: timeline search. Instead of scrolling through hundreds of video clips, you can jump directly to recorded events and quickly locate specific moments.
For homeowners dealing with package theft, vehicle incidents, or property disputes, this can save significant time.
Vivint Playback DVR Pricing
According to Vivint’s official offerings, the Playback DVR service typically costs between $4.99 and $9.99 per month as an add-on subscription for eligible customers.
The overall investment depends on your existing equipment and installation requirements.
| Product or Service | Estimated Price |
| Playback DVR Service Add-On | $4.99–$9.99/month |
| Vivint Smart Drive DVR | $249–$399 |
| Outdoor Camera Pro | $399–$499 |
| Doorbell Camera Pro | $249–$399 |
| Complete Vivint Home Security System | $1,000–$3,500+ |
Prices may vary based on promotions, equipment packages, financing options, and professional installation requirements.
Technical Specifications
The system combines cloud-connected features with local recording capabilities to create a reliable security solution.
| Specification | Details |
| Recording Type | Continuous 24/7 Recording |
| Camera Support | Up to 12 Cameras |
| Storage Duration | Up to 10 Days |
| Mobile Access | iOS and Android |
| Event Detection | AI-Powered |
| Video Search | Timeline and Event Markers |
Vivint Smart Drive Specifications
For homeowners using the legacy Vivint Smart Drive, the hardware includes:
| Feature | Specification |
| Storage Capacity | 1TB Hard Drive |
| Camera Support | Up to 4 Cameras |
| Video Retention | Up to 30 Days |
| Connectivity | Ethernet and Wi-Fi |
| Power Supply | 12V DC, 2A |
| Dimensions | 5.9 x 8.0 x 3.3 inches |
| Weight | 1.5 pounds |
How Vivint Camera Recording Compares to Standard Security Systems
Many traditional security cameras rely heavily on motion-triggered recording. While this approach conserves storage space, it can occasionally miss important activity that occurs between motion events.
Continuous video recording creates a more complete record of what happens around your property.
Benefits of Continuous Recording
- Captures activity around the clock
- Creates a complete event timeline
- Helps during insurance claims
- Supports law enforcement investigations
- Reduces the chance of missing critical moments
According to the FBI’s Uniform Crime Reporting Program, property crimes continue to affect millions of households annually, making reliable surveillance an important consideration for homeowners.
At the same time, continuous recording requires additional storage and often comes with higher subscription costs. This is one of the trade-offs buyers should consider before purchasing.

Pros and Cons
Pros
- True 24/7 recording coverage
- Excellent timeline search functionality
- Strong integration with the Vivint home security system
- Useful AI-powered event detection
- Convenient mobile access and playback
- Supports multiple cameras
Cons
- Higher cost than many DIY alternatives
- Monthly subscription required
- Limited compatibility with non-Vivint devices
- Professional installation may increase overall expenses
